Tapping into the Power of the Sun: Solar Energy Systems Explained

Solar energy systems are rapidly becoming a popular choice for homeowners and businesses alike, offering a clean, renewable, and cost-effective alternative to traditional fossil fuels. These systems work by converting sunlight into electricity using photovoltaic (PV) panels. Solar panels are made up of solar cell materials that generate an electrical current when exposed by sunlight. The electricity generated can then be used to power homes, businesses, or even sent back into the power system.

  • Several are variations of solar energy systems available, including grid-tied systems, off-grid systems, and hybrid systems. Grid-tied systems are connected to the electrical grid, allowing homeowners to export excess electricity back to the utility company. Off-grid systems, on the other hand, are independent, meaning they don't rely on the grid for power.
  • Solar systems offer a range of benefits, including reducing your carbon footprint, saving money on energy bills, and increasing the value of your home.

Investing in a solar energy system can be a smart decision for both environmental and financial reasons. With advancements in technology and decreasing costs, solar power is becoming increasingly accessible to more and more people.

Maximizing Efficiency in Residential Solar Energy Installations

Harnessing the power of the sun for residential energy needs is a exceptional choice. To truly optimize the efficiency of your solar installation, consider a range of factors. First and foremost, ensure optimal panel placement to receive the maximum amount of sunlight throughout the day. Investigate the orientation and tilt angle of your roof, as these can substantially impact energy production. Secondly, select high-quality solar panels with a proven track record of efficiency.

In addition, integrate a smart inverter system that can optimally manage the flow of energy. Regularly service your panels and elements to guarantee they are operating at peak performance. Finally, explore energy storage solutions, such as battery installations, to store excess solar energy for nighttime use. By following these strategies, you can greatly boost the efficiency of your residential solar energy installation and minimize your reliance on traditional energy sources.

Off-Grid Solar Systems: Choosing the Right Solution

When considering solar power for your home, you'll discover two primary systems: grid-connected and off-grid. Selecting the ideal solution depends on your unique needs and requirements. Grid-connected systems harness power from the utility grid, supplementing it with solar energy. This alternative offers ease of use, but you're still tied to the grid. Off-grid systems, on the other hand, are fully independent, creating all their own power and storing it in batteries. This delivers energy independence, but requires a larger upfront investment and greater maintenance.

  • Considerations to assess include your energy consumption, budget, location, and nearby regulations. Consulting with a qualified solar installer can help you in making the best decision for your needs.
